程序员人均学历
-
程序员人均学历与科技发展、教育程度等因素密切相关。一般而言,从事编程工作的人员需要具备较高的学历背景,以便能够掌握复杂的编程技术和解决实际问题的能力。然而,具体的人均学历情况会因国家、地区和公司的不同而有所差异。
在大多数发达国家,程序员通常需要拥有大学本科甚至研究生学位。这是因为大学教育提供了广泛的计算机科学和软件工程课程,这些课程涵盖了编程基础、算法和数据结构、计算机网络、数据库等重要知识点。通过系统的学习,学生可以获得深入理解并掌握编程语言和技术的能力。同时,大学还提供了丰富的实践机会,如实习、研究项目等,使学生能够将所学知识应用于实际项目中。
然而,也有一些程序员是通过自学或参加非正式的培训课程进入行业的。这些人可能只有中学或职业学校的学历,但通过自主学习和实践,他们也能够掌握编程技能。对于这些人员而言,他们可能需要更多的时间和努力来填补所缺乏的理论知识,但他们仍然可以成为出色的程序员。
除了学历,编程行业还高度重视技能和实践经验。一些公司更注重候选人的实际开发能力,而不仅仅是学历。因此,许多程序员会通过参与项目、开源贡献、参加编程竞赛等方式来提升自己的技能和经验。
综上所述,程序员人均学历在不同国家和地区有所差异,但一般来说,较高的学历背景能够为程序员提供更坚实的理论基础和更广泛的知识面,但他们也可以通过自学和实践来获得编程技能。最终,技能和实践经验在编程行业中同样重要。
1 years ago -
程序员人均学历对于不同国家和地区可能会有所不同。然而,根据一般的观察和调查,以下是程序员人均学历的一些常见情况:
1. 学士学位:大多数程序员拥有学士学位,这是他们进入编程行业的基本要求。学士学位通常是计算机科学、软件工程、信息技术等相关领域的学位。
2. 硕士学位:一些程序员选择继续深造,获得硕士学位。硕士学位通常可以为程序员提供更深入的知识和技能,使他们在职业生涯中获得更多的机会和升职的可能性。
3. 博士学位:虽然博士学位相对较少,但一些程序员选择攻读博士学位,尤其是想从事研究或教学领域的程序员。博士学位可以为他们提供深入的专业知识和研究能力。
4. 证书和培训班:除了学位,一些程序员还通过参加证书考试和专业培训班来提高自己的技能。这些证书可以是专业认证,如微软的MCP(Microsoft Certified Professional),或特定领域的认证,如网络安全。
5. 自学:一些程序员没有通过传统的学位学习,而是通过自学来获得相关的编程知识和技能。自学的方式可以包括在线教育平台、教程和书籍等。这些自学者可能在工作经验和项目上有更多的侧重。
需要注意的是,这只是一个一般的观察,实际情况可能会因国家、地区、公司和个人的差异而有所不同。不同的编程领域也可能对学历有不同的要求。最重要的是,无论学历如何,在编程领域成功的关键是不断学习和不断提升自己的技能。
1 years ago -
程序员人均学历的数据并不是固定的,因为程序员这个职业领域涵盖了很多不同层次和领域的技能需求,所以学历水平也会有差异。不过,根据统计数据和行业调查,可以得出一些普遍情况。
一般来说,大多数程序员都有至少本科学历,尤其是在大型软件公司和高科技行业中。本科学历通常是他们进入程序员职业的最低门槛之一,因为它给予了他们在计算机科学及相关领域的基本知识和技能。
同时,也有不少程序员拥有硕士或博士学位。这些高等教育背景通常使他们在某个特定的领域或技术方向上具有更深入的专业知识,例如人工智能、数据科学、网络安全等。在一些研究型机构或大型科技公司,拥有硕士或博士学位的程序员往往在项目研发和技术创新方面扮演着重要角色。
此外,还有一部分程序员并没有完成大学学业,但通过自学和培训获得了相关的技术知识和技能。他们可能是通过在线教育平台、培训机构或自己阅读相关书籍、参与项目实践等途径,掌握了编程语言和开发技术。这类程序员的学历水平更加多样化,主要取决于他们自身的学习和努力程度。
综上所述,程序员人均学历并没有一个统一的标准,会根据个人的背景、教育经历和职业需求而有所差异。然而,高等学历仍然是很多程序员进入这个职业的基本要求,而在不断发展的科技领域中不断学习和提升自己的能力也是必不可少的。
1 years ago